Transaction 542e0d34ac775a629d1dcbf61da95bfe939c5a2d676554cad6b9093560626099
1 Input
1 Output
-
542e0d34ac775a629d1dcbf61da95bfe939c5a2d676554cad6b9093560626099:0
- value
- 688721
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4830133dbc653cd1e1e32585c9e91f913ea68be4 OP_EQUAL
- address
- 38GiAgBEnNFbKaEPnorUpdr35HgefeYqxk